It would probably taste a lot better with a good amount of the all purpose dill seasoning, even with the dijon and cheese. Maybe some bacon crumbles. Lots of garlic... :chef: Just throwing that out there since she seems to be set on the idea... It sounds like it could end up like a giant grilled tuna sandwich, which my kids love and we have quite often here. That is what I do with our grilled cheese/tuna sandwiches. Sometimes I use sharp cheddar in place of a milder cheese and it ends up pretty good! Maybe try it yourself first too. It may taste better than you think? Maybe?
